If you’re a high roller…
High rollers will find plenty to love at try casino cruise Cruise. The site hosts several high-stakes jackpot games, where the rewards can be life-changing. For instance, some progressive jackpots can reach into the millions. However, it’s crucial to be aware of the wagering requirements—typically around 35x—before cashing out. This means if you claim a bonus, you’ll need to wager 35 times the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, with a £100 bonus, you’d need to bet £3,500.
Additionally, the maximum withdrawal limit is capped at £5,000 per week, which can be a hurdle for those with big wins. Therefore, if you hit a significant jackpot, you might have to wait for multiple weeks to access your full winnings. This is a downside I’ve seen frustrate some players in the past.

Understanding Payment Methods
When it comes to cashing out your winnings, the method you choose can significantly impact your experience. Casino Cruise offers various options, including credit/debit cards, e-wallets, and cryptocurrencies. Here’s how they stack up:
| Payment Method | Withdrawal Time | Fees | Min/Max Limits |
|---|---|---|---|
| Credit/Debit Card | 3-5 days | No fees | £10 / £5,000 weekly |
| E-Wallet (e.g., PayPal) | 24 hours | No fees | £10 / £5,000 weekly |
| Cryptocurrency (e.g., Bitcoin) | 1-2 hours | No fees | £10 / £5,000 weekly |
Using e-wallets tends to be the fastest option, allowing for withdrawals within about 24 hours. Cryptocurrency transactions are even quicker, generally taking only 1-2 hours. However, not all players are comfortable with crypto, which can be a barrier for some. On the other hand, bank cards might be the most familiar route for many, but they often come with longer wait times.
